首页 > 数据库 > MySQL > 正文

初次安装Mysql5 7以上版本后初始root密码找不到的难题

2024-07-24 12:35:49
字体:
来源:转载
供稿:网友
  mysql5.7新增的特性中主要的一方面就是极大增强了安全性,安装Mysql后默认会为root@localhost用户创建一个随机密码,这个随机密码在不同系统上需要使用不同方式查找,否则无法登录mysql并修改初始密码。
 
  在Centos 7系统上使用rpm命令安装Mysql后,mysql的配置文件是/etc/my.cnf,打开该文件,可以看到mysql的datadir和log文件等的配置信息,如下:
 
  datadir=/var/lib/mysql
 
  log-error=/var/log/mysqld.log
 
  打开/var/log/mysqld.log文件,搜索字符串A temporary password is generated for root@localhost:,可以找到这个随机密码,通常这一行日志在log文件的最初几行,比较容易看到。
 
  使用找到的随机密码登录mysql,首次登录后,mysql要比必须修改默认密码,否则不能执行任何其他数据库操作,这样体现了不断增强的Mysql安全性。

(编辑:武林网)

发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表